Thanks. i guess I'll try that next. I'm also gonna take another look at the mfi fuse. I checked it twice and it didn't look burnt. I'll go over it again though just to be sure.
if you do check the fuse, use a voltometer and set it on the ohm's setting. that'l tell you if you have a circuit (in other words if your fuse is still good)

well idk abuot a crank angle sensor but the crank position sensor is abuot the oil filter , and when lift your car up its almost right across from the front wheels, and the sensor has a wireing harness connected to it, and its only held in by one screw.. it didnt fix my prob but try it... there only like 72 dollars new...
